Note that any value greater than the size of the largest input file will have no effect.Īdding -ms=on will enable solid compression support, which improves compression even more, but also makes extraction slower and means you won't be able to recover individual files if the archive is corrupted. It'll make compression even better, but slower, and consume more memory. If your file has a lot of long-distance redundancy, you can change the dictionary side from 128m to 256m. They are both very capable compression algorithms - which one works best depends entirely upon the input files. The first one uses LZMA, the second uses PPMd (The algorithm better known as that used in RAR files).
